From what I know this is a basic TRF black top. I'm not too versed in the TRF or TSNS, honestly. I'm taking all information about them from the guy that built them. I personally put these on a scale, however and they were 87lbs each fully built. Typical TI 15" basket, OEM TSNS softs. Shipping weight was either 104 or 114 lbs boxed, don't remember.
I do not have a TSNS motor. Boy do I wish I did. Not to pick at these subs in any way. They have blown away every expectation I had of them and then had plenty more left in them.
